Cincinnati, OH (November 16, 2024) – On Saturday evening, emergency responders were dispatched to the scene of a vehicle collision at the intersection of W Court St and Elm St following reports of injuries.
The incident was first reported at 10:59 PM EST by a 911 caller, prompting an immediate response from local police and firefighters. Emergency crews, including multiple medic units, arrived shortly after to assist those involved. Paramedics provided care to individuals suffering from a variety of injuries, while firefighters worked to secure the area and ensure public safety.
Additional medical personnel were called to the scene at 11:21 PM EST to provide further assistance, indicating the seriousness of the situation. The intersection remained partially restricted as responders attended to the injured and began clearing the site. The circumstances surrounding the crash are currently under investigation as authorities work to determine contributing factors.
